@import url("https://use.typekit.net/tvq4koj.css");

body.login div#login h1 a {
  background-image: url("/wp-content/uploads/2023/12/K-DAST_logo.svg");
  background-size: 100%;
	background-position: center top;
	background-repeat: no-repeat;
	height: 100px;
	font-size: 20px;
	font-weight: normal;
	line-height: 1.3em;
	margin: 0 auto 25px;
	padding: 0;
	text-decoration: none;
	width: 200px;
	text-indent: -9999px;
	outline: none;
	overflow: hidden;
	display: block;
}

body.login {
  background-color: #052931;
  background-size: cover;
  font-family: 'source-sans-pro';
  background-repeat: no-repeat;
 
  
}

a{
	color: #bc4c2c;
}

a:hover{
	color: #bc4c2c;
}

.login #backtoblog a, .login #nav a {
    text-decoration: none;
    color: #f4f4f4;
}
.login #backtoblog a:hover, .login #nav a:hover, .login h1 a:hover {
    color: #f4f4f4;
}

.dashicons-translation:before {
    color: #babd1f;
}

.login #login_error, .login .message, .login .success {
  border-left: 6px solid #babd1f;
}

.wp-core-ui .button-primary {
	background-color: #bc4c2c;
    border: 1px solid #bc4c2c;
    color: #f4f4f4;
    padding: 16px 32px;
	font-size: 14px;
    font-weight: 700;
    transition-duration: 0.4s;
    border-radius: 0;
}

.wp-core-ui .button-primary:hover {
    color: #052931;
	background-color: #babd1f;
    border: 1px solid #babd1f;
}
